Sandy Greiner

Sandy Greiner, BS, NPCT, has been teaching Pilates on the North Shore for 18 years.

Her passion is to guide each client to better health and vitality with an individualized Pilates program. "Pilates helps me manage back pain from years of ballet. It develops a mind-body connection that moves my life forward. I love seeing clients thrive from their Pilates practice."

She earned the 500 hour Balanced Body certificate and is a Nationally Certified Pilates Teacher.

Sandy has completed over 15 years of Pilates continuing education coursework and has practiced Pilates with teachers from a variety of Pilates lineages, both classical and contemporary.

Some of her additional training and certifications include Arcus, AFAA personal training, TRX Suspension Training, Oov, MELT, MOTR, and Pre-and Postnatal Pilates. Prior to teaching Pilates, Sandy worked in the wellness field as director and creator of Healthy Expectations, Inc. in Chicago and business development manager at Rush Corporate Health Center in Chicago.
